ESET has published its latest Threat Report, which summarizes trends in the cyberthreat landscape, as observed through ESET telemetry from December 2024 to May 2025, as well as observations from the company's experts.
One of the most striking developments during this period was the emergence of ClickFix, a new deceptive attack vector, whose activity skyrocketed by more than 500% compared to the second half of 2024. This makes it one of the fastest growing threats, accounting for almost 8% of all blocked attacks in the first half of 2025. Now, ClickFix is the second most common attack vector after phishing.
